Which of the freshwater generators listed below requires a source of heat and evaporates sea water at a location other than a heat exchanger surface?

Official USCG Answer & Rule Citation

Correct Answer: Option D — Flash type

Flash evaporators operate by spraying heated seawater into a chamber maintained at a lower pressure, causing the water to 'flash' into steam. This evaporation occurs in the space within the chamber rather than directly on a heat exchanger surface, which helps minimize scale formation on the heating elements themselves.
